A quote from a Morgantown company means little until you know who is quoting: a carrier with trucks and crews in the area, or a sales office reselling your move. That distinction is the first line of every report, and it decides how your moving day actually goes. What should I look at before booking a Morgantown mover?
Three rows on the report: carrier or broker, fleet size against what the salesperson promised, and the Hostage Goods complaint row. A company with no trucks, broker-only authority or a hostage-load complaint deserves a hard pass, whatever its star ratings say.
